This programme leads to the award of the certified title TP – Secure Infrastructure Administrator, with the certification registered on 01-09-2023, issued by the Ministry of Labour, Full Employment and Integration.

presentation

The Secure Infrastructure Administrator (AIS) implements, manages and secures both local and cloud-based IT infrastructures. They design and deploy solutions that meet evolving requirements and implement and optimise monitoring systems.

Programme objectives

  • Apply best practices in infrastructure administration
  • Administer and secure network infrastructures
  • Administer and secure system infrastructures
  • Administer and secure virtualised infrastructures
  • Design a technical solution that meets evolving infrastructure requirements
  • Deploy infrastructure upgrades into production
  • Implement and optimise infrastructure monitoring
  • Contribute to measuring and analysing the security level of the infrastructure
  • Participate in the development and implementation of the security policy
  • Participate in the detection and handling of security incidents

Students entering the first year must achieve an average of 10/20 across all assessments in order to progress to the second year. The same rule applies for progression from the second to the third year. To obtain the qualification, all competency blocks must be successfully completed. However, it is possible to validate one or more competency blocks independently.

FURTHER STUDIES: Although this qualification is primarily designed to prepare students for professional entry, further studies are possible, particularly towards a Master’s degree in Computer Science – Cybersecurity track, a Master’s in Information Systems Administration and Security, a Master’s in Networks and Telecommunications, or a specialised Master in IT Security, Cloud Computing or Information Systems Architecture, offered by institutions specialising in computer science.
